Multiple Choice

What is released as a phosphate ion during the action of a phosphatase?

Explanation:
The action of a phosphatase involves the removal of a phosphate group from a substrate, typically as part of a biochemical reaction. This enzymatic activity specifically releases inorganic phosphate, which is often referred to simply as a phosphate ion. Phosphatases play a vital role in various metabolic pathways, including the regulation of signal transduction and energy metabolism. When the phosphatase enzyme acts on a substrate that has a phosphate group, it catalyzes the hydrolytic removal of that phosphate. This process liberates the phosphate ion, which can then participate in other biochemical reactions or regulatory processes within the cell. In the context of the other choices, ATP and ADP are nucleotides that store and transfer energy in cells, but they do not constitute the phosphate ion released by phosphatase activity. Glucose is a simple sugar that serves as a primary energy source in cells, but it is unrelated to the function of a phosphatase regarding phosphate release. Therefore, the correct understanding is that a phosphate ion is indeed released as a product of the action of a phosphatase, making it the right answer.

Biology Major Field Test Overview

The Biology Major Field Test is designed to assess the knowledge and understanding of fundamental concepts in biology. This exam is an important tool for students to demonstrate their mastery of biological principles and is commonly used by universities to evaluate their biology programs.

Exam Overview

The Biology Major Field Test evaluates a wide range of topics that are essential to the field of biology. It typically includes questions related to cellular biology, genetics, evolution, ecology, and organismal biology. Understanding these core areas is crucial for achieving a satisfactory score on the exam.

Exam Format

The exam format generally consists of multiple-choice questions that test the breadth of a student's knowledge in biology. While the exact number of questions may vary, you can expect to encounter a mix of straightforward queries and more complex scenarios that require critical thinking. It is essential to familiarize yourself with the exam structure to efficiently manage your time during the test.

Common Content Areas

  1. Cell Biology: Questions in this area focus on cellular structures, functions, and processes, including cellular respiration and photosynthesis.
  2. Genetics: This section assesses your understanding of heredity, genetic variation, and the molecular basis of genetics.
  3. Evolution: Expect questions that cover the principles of evolution, natural selection, and the history of life.
  4. Ecology: This area involves the study of organisms and their interactions with the environment, including population dynamics and ecosystems.
  5. Organismal Biology: Questions may include topics related to the anatomy and physiology of various organisms, including plants and animals.
